Start your day at the Port of Aberdeen, for a journey filled with breathtaking views and captivating stops. Your first destination is the stunning Falls of Feugh, just a short drive away. Stretch your legs and take in the natural beauty of the cascading waters, with a chance to spot salmon swimming upstream, adding to the magical scenery.

Next, immerse yourself in the grandeur of Balmoral Castle, one of Scotland’s most iconic landmarks. Wander the castle grounds at your own pace, enjoy a delightful lunch at the Balmoral Café, and dive into the royal history of this majestic residence. From the tranquil gardens to the elegant interiors, Balmoral offers a truly royal experience.

Then, head to Ballater, a charming Victorian village nestled in the Cairngorms National Park. Explore quaint streets, browse local shops for handmade crafts, and soak in the peaceful atmosphere.

End your day with a scenic drive back to Aberdeen, reflecting on the beauty and history you’ve experienced

Falls of Feugh

Your first destination is the Falls of Feugh, just a short drive from Aberdeen. Here, you’ll have the chance to stretch your legs and soak in the natural beauty of the falls. Famous for their picturesque scenery, you may even catch a glimpse of salmon attempting to swim upstream. Even without the salmon, the sight of the cascading water is sure to leave you in awe.
